Wagering Requirements and Game Contributions

The 10x wagering requirement on the VBet bonus is the headline number, but the fine print on game contributions is where the real detail lives. Slots contribute 100% towards the wagering target, which is standard. However, table games like blackjack and roulette contribute significantly less. European roulette at 2.7% house edge, contributes only 10% to the wagering requirement. That means if you try to clear the £2,000 turnover by playing roulette, you would need to place £20,000 in bets to satisfy the terms. That is an expected loss of £540 — far more than the bonus is worth.

Blackjack with basic strategy, which has a house edge of approximately 0%, contributes even less at around 5%. This is a deliberate design choice by the casino to steer players toward slots, which have a higher house edge. For a player focused on value, the optimal strategy is to play high-RTP slots (96% or above) exclusively until the wagering is cleared. Games like Blood Suckers (98% RTP) or Jackpot 6000 (98% RTP) are ideal candidates if they’re included in the eligible games list. Always check the specific game exclusions in the T&Cs before spinning.

Expected Value Analysis of the VBet Bonus

Let us run the numbers on the VBet welcome offer to determine its true expected value. Assume a deposit of £20 to claim the minimum bonus of £20. The wagering requirement is 10x, so you need to place £200 in bets. If you play a slot with a 96% RTP (4% house edge), the expected cost of meeting the wagering is £200 x 4% = £8. Your net expected return from the bonus is £20 minus £8, which equals £12. That is a 60% return on your deposit before considering the free spins. Not bad at all.

If you deposit the full £200 to claim the maximum £200 bonus, the wagering target becomes £2,000. At a 4% house edge, the expected cost is £80, leaving an expected return of £120 from the bonus. That is a 60% return on your £200 deposit. The free spins add a bit more value, typically worth around £5 to £10 in expected terms depending on the game and your luck. Casino Economics: How VBet Makes the Offer Work

From the casino’s perspective, the welcome bonus is a customer acquisition cost. VBet is betting that a portion of new players won’t complete the wagering, that some will play high-house-edge games, and that a fraction will become long-term depositors. The 10x wagering cap limits the casino’s ability to extract value from bonus hunters, but the 30-day expiry and the £5 max bet rule tilt the odds back in the house’s favour. Players who try to grind through the wagering with low-variance games will take longer, increasing the chance that they make a mistake or lose patience.

The exclusion of high-RTP games from the eligible list is another lever the casino pulls. If Blood Suckers or similar 98%+ RTP slots are excluded, the effective house edge for bonus clearing rises to around 5%, increasing the casino’s margin. The free spins are also a clever tool — they create a sense of urgency with the 72-hour expiry, pushing players to log in and play immediately. Overall, the economics are balanced: the player has a genuine edge if they play optimally, but the casino relies on behavioural biases and imperfect play to maintain profitability.
